The 3 months correlation between Guidemark and Pimco is 0.63.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ding Guidemark Large Cap and Pimco Extended Duration in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on Pimco Extended Duration and Guidemark Large is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Guidemark Large Cap are associated (or correlated) with Pimco Extended. Pair Trading with Guidemark Large and Pimco Extended
The main advantage of trading using opposite Guidemark Large and Pimco Extended posit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Guidemark Large position performs unexpectedly, Pimco Extended can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
